Shinko F003/R003 Stealth Street Radial - Rear Tires

Average Customer Rating:   5.0 out of 5 (based on 3 ratings)

  • The near slick dimple design is very popular with drag racers, production racers and the serious sport rider
  • Compounded for rapid warm up and grip like a slick

 Super Sticky Buns!

By Zack from Livermore, CA on 10/25/2007

Pros: The buns appear to be medium/soft grade type of rubber. In the dry, these buns have performed excellent. Either leaned over in turns, on the freeway, or on the street, these tires are confidence inspiring (except in the wet).

Cons: In the wet, these tires were not so great to say the least. Even once I got them all warm and toasty, traction felt very loose. Perhaps their limited tread pattern was responsible for the loose grip behavior in the wet. Who knows? I felt itâ??s worth mentioning, light drizzle rain apparently didnâ??t affect the traction very much. Just donâ??t go mach-3 everywhere if you know what I mean.

Comments: In closing, I still decided to give these tires 5 stars. Iâ??m a starving college student, and for the money, these buns are the best deal in-townâ?¦hands down!
